Before the 2018 contests, Rubio and then-Sen. Bill Nelson sent a letter to all Florida election officials warning about Russian hacking — written at the request of Senate Intelligence Chairman Richard Burr and ranking Democrat Mark Warner . Nelson also warned that Russians were actively inside Florida county networks at the time, but that wasn’t confirmed by the Department of Homeland Security or the other senators.
